About Plentywood, MT
Plentywood is a small community in Montana with a population of 1,677 residents. The median household income is $62,163 per year, which is near the national average. The median age in Plentywood is 49.5 years.
Housing in Plentywood has a median home value of $148,800 and median monthly rent of $755. Of the 980 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 505 owner-occupied and 216 renter-occupied units.
The unemployment rate in Plentywood is 4.4% and the poverty rate is 12.5%. 21.3%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 9 minutes.
Cost of Living in Plentywood, MT
Compared to national averages, Plentywood has a median household income of $62,163 (17% below the national median of $75,149). Home values average $148,800, which is 39% below the national median. Monthly rent at $755 is 35% below the US average of $1,163. Within Montana, Plentywood's income is 6% below the state average of $65,821, and home values are 48% below the state median of $288,703.
